Clomid is a measure that is taken after completing a steroid cycle. Commonly referred to as clomiphene citrate. It is not an anabolic steroid, but a prescription drug commonly prescribed for infertile women. This is due to the fact that clomiphene citrate has a pronounced ability to stimulate ovulation. This is due to blocking the activity of estrogen in the body
Used in post-cycle bodybuilding, it acts directly on the hypothalamus and increases the production of LH-releasing hormone, which in the later stage initiates the production of testosterone, stopped by taking steroids.
